By:  Truan                                            S.B. No. 1040

                                A BILL TO BE ENTITLED

                                       AN ACT

 1-1     relating to programs of institutions of higher education that

 1-2     address small business research and development.

 1-3           B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:

 1-4           SECTION 1.  Subchapter C, Chapter 61, Education Code, is

 1-5     amended by adding Section 61.0775 to read as follows:

 1-6           Sec. 61.0775.  BUSINESS RESEARCH AND DEVELOPMENT.  (a)  The

 1-7     board shall conduct a continuing study of the programs and other

 1-8     efforts of institutions of higher education to address the needs of

 1-9     small businesses in this state for assistance in research,

1-10     development, and prototyping.

1-11           (b)  At times the board considers appropriate, the board

1-12     shall make recommendations to appropriate institutions of higher

1-13     education or the legislature on actions that may be taken to

1-14     address the needs of small businesses as described by Subsection

1-15     (a) in the most cost-effective manner, including through the

1-16     participation by institutions of higher education in partnerships,

1-17     ventures, or projects that promote the commercialization of

1-18     technology for or by small businesses.

1-19           SECTION 2.  This Act takes effect September 1, 1997.
